Portland Trail Blazers vsCharlotte Hornets Prediction
In an upcoming matchup between the Charlotte Hornets and the Portland Trail Blazers, our BetQL model favors the Hornets as solid 67.7 percent favorites. The Hornets are forecasted to shoot slightly better from the field at 46.2 percent compared to the Trail Blazers' 45.8 percent. Additionally, Charlotte holds an advantage in taking care of the ball, committing fewer turnovers at 12.1 per game compared to Portland's 14.0 turnovers. When it comes to three-point shooting, the Hornets have been more efficient, making 15.6 three pointers per game on 36.7 percent shooting, while the Trail Blazers are making 12.3 threes at a rate of 34.2 percent.
Key player statistical data may sway the outcome of the game, with Brandon Miller leading the Hornets in scoring with an impressive average of 25.0 points per game while Vasilije Micic facilitates play with 7.7 assists per game for Charlotte. On the other side, Deandre Ayton and Miles Bridges contribute significantly in rebounding for their respective teams. Sportsbooks and handicappers have set the line at CHA -1.5 with a total of 213.5 points expected to be scored in this closely contested matchup between two struggling teams.
